Kanji Detail for 混 - "to mix, to confuse"

  • Meaning

    混 means "to mix, to confuse." Also associated with muddy.

    1. Mix - To combine different things; to blend.

    2. Confuse - To make unclear; to jumble.

    3. Muddy - Turbid; unclear.

    4. Crowded - Full of people; congested.

  • Words using

    • 混乱 こんらん Listen disorder; chaos; confusion
    • 混迷 こんめい Listen turmoil; chaos; confusion
    • 混戦 こんせん Listen confused fight; free-for-all; melee
    • 混合 こんごう Listen mixing; mixture; meld
    • 混雑 こんざつ Listen congestion; crush; crowding
    • 混ぜ合わす まぜあわす Listen to mix together; to blend; to compound
    • 混血 こんけつ Listen mixed race; mixed parentage
    • 混成 こんせい Listen mixed (e.g. team, chorus)
  • Four-character idioms with

    • 公私混同 こうしこんどう Listen mixing of public and private affairs; mixing business with personal affairs; mixing work and private matters
    • 玉石混交 ぎょくせきこんこう Listen mixed bag; mixture of good and bad; jumble of wheat and chaff
    • 神仏混淆 しんぶつこんこう Listen synthesis of Shintoism and Buddhism
    • 虚実混交 きょじつこんこう Listen mishmash of truth and untruth; mixture of fiction and fact
    • 雅俗混交 がぞくこんこう Listen mixture of both culture and vulgarism; mixture of both literary and colloquial (language)

  • Dictionary Citations

    The meaning above is based on the following sources:

    KANJIDIC2 A comprehensive Japanese-English kanji dictionary

    mix; blend; confuse

    Unihan Unicode Han Database for CJK characters

    to mix, blend, mingle; to bumble along

    CC-CEDICT A Chinese-English dictionary

    muddy; turbid (variant of 渾|浑[hun2]); brainless; foolish (variant of 渾|浑[hun2]); Taiwan pr. [hun4]

    Make Me a Hanzi Open-source Chinese character data

    muddy, confused; to mix, to blend; to mingle

    XSZD Xuéshēng Zìdiǎn (學生字典) - Student's Dictionary

    Mixed. Colloquially, adding or intermingling is also called 混. Committing fraud to make things difficult to distinguish is called 弊混. | 混沌 (Hun-tun). Before heaven and earth were separated, when primordial energy was undifferentiated. | The appearance of great water flowing. Mencius says: "The original spring gushes forth" (原泉混混). Today commonly written as 滾.
